iPhone 17 Pro Max launch on 9 September: Last minute leak reveals key specs

As anticipation builds for the launch of the iPhone 17 series on September 9, Apple is ramping up excitement with its Awe Droppng event. Recent leaks have surfaced, shedding light on significant upgrades, particularly for the iPhone 17 Pro models. Among the most notable enhancements is the introduction of a new 48MP telephoto sensor, a substantial upgrade from the existing 12MP sensor. A leaked document from a German carrier, revealed by tipster Jukan on X (formerly Twitter), indicates that the new Pro models may offer an impressive 8x zoom capability, surpassing the current 5x zoom. In addition to camera improvements, the new iPhone 17 Pro series is rumored to feature enhanced heat dissipation technology. The upcoming models are expected to transition from a titanium frame to an aluminum-glass design, which is believed to provide superior heat management. This shift is critical as aluminum is more efficient at conducting and dissipating heat compared to titanium. Furthermore, the leak hints at the inclusion of a 3D vapor cooling chamber system, a feature gaining traction in both mid-range and flagship Android devices. Analysts, including Ming-Chi Kuo and leaker Majin Bu, have previously hinted at this cooling technology's presence in the iPhone 17 series. Unlike the graphite cooling pads in current models, the vapor chamber utilizes a small amount of liquid contained in a metal compartment to efficiently manage heat, which could enhance performance during high-demand tasks like gaming or video recording. The document also reveals that the iPhone 17 Pro models may support 8K video recording capabilities. This functionality is expected to stem from the upgraded telephoto lens, allowing all three rear cameras to operate at a uniform 48MP resolution, crucial for capturing high-definition video. In addition to these features, the iPhone 17 Pro lineup is anticipated to boast a new 24MP selfie camera, replacing the previous 12MP sensor. Other expected upgrades include a smaller dynamic island and Apple's latest A19 Pro processor, alongside an increase in RAM to 12GB, enhancing multitasking and artificial intelligence capabilities. As the launch date approaches, enthusiasts are eager to discover the full range of features and pricing for the iPhone 17 Pro, Pro Max, and Air models.
